Output 8c63ce30469d1bb2be01e7f3f280c05b32d447f25a8a6dd1eefeed4acb671596:0

value
801308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a5bb4d385989568c45ef6cbfcd52190f90cfbae OP_EQUAL
address
3FmBqxKwDbNva8UQjzhoWSne3B6CjGPThK
transaction
8c63ce30469d1bb2be01e7f3f280c05b32d447f25a8a6dd1eefeed4acb671596
spent
true